    Abstract: A refrigeration system includes: a vacuum chamber forming a cooling region accommodating an object; a cooling unit that cools the object accommodated in the cooling region; and a heating unit disposed in the cooling region to generate heat. The heating unit includes an optical fiber that guides light provided from an outside of the vacuum chamber, and a heating block that is disposed in the cooling region and that receives the light emitted from the optical fiber, to generate heat. The heating block includes a closed region configured to be isolated from the cooling region. A light-emitting end of the optical fiber is exposed to the closed region.

    Abstract: A photoelectric tube includes a housing including a light transmitting portion, an electron emitting portion including a photoelectric surface disposed inside the housing, an electron capturing portion disposed between the light transmitting portion and the photoelectric surface inside the housing, and a conductive layer disposed on a light transmitting portion side of at least a part of the electron capturing portion to face the photoelectric surface inside the housing and configured to allow light to pass therethrough.

    Abstract: A photoelectric tube includes a housing including a light transmitting portion, an electron emitting portion held by a recess provided in the housing, the electron emitting portion including a concave photoelectric surface facing a light transmitting portion side inside the housing, and an electron capturing portion disposed between the light transmitting portion and the photoelectric surface inside the housing. At least a part of the electron capturing portion is located inside a region on an inside of the photoelectric surface.
